LAWS(CAL)-2014-2-41

ANOWARA BIBI Vs. SK. NASIRUDDIN

Decided On February 26, 2014
ANOWARA BIBI Appellant
V/S
SK. NASIRUDDIN Respondents

JUDGEMENT

(1.) THIS second appeal is at the instance of the plaintiff/respondent and is directed against the judgment and decree dated August 31, 2009 passed by the learned Civil Judge (Senior Division), 4th Court, Alipore in Title Appeal No.1 of 2007 thereby reversing the judgment and decree dated November 29, 2006 passed by the learned Civil Judge (Junior Division), 1st Additional Court at Alipore in Title Suit No.38 of 2006.

(2.) THE plaintiff instituted the aforesaid suit for declaration of title, permanent injunction and other reliefs against the defendants in respect of the suit property as described in the schedule to the plaint before the learned Trial Judge contending, inter alia, that Sk. Mojahar, husband of the plaintiff was the owner of the suit property. He died leaving the plaintiff, his wife as the sole owner and as such, according to the provisions of Sunni School of Mohammedan Law, she became the absolute owner of the suit property. The defendants are the complete strangers and they have no right, title and interest over the suit property, but, on December 3, 1992 the defendant no.1 along with some men tried to take forceful possession of the suit property by disclosing that Sk. Mojahar gifted the suit property to the defendants by a registered deed of Hebanama dated October 14, 1992.

(3.) THE defendant no.1 is contesting the said suit by filing a written statement denying the material allegations raised in the plaint. It is also the specific case of the defendant no.1 that Khairon Bibi alias Khaironnesha Bibi is the sister of Sk. Mojahar and she has been residing in a portion of the suit property with her husband all along by making a structure thereon for the last 25 years. The defendant no.1 has also contended that he has been residing in the suit premises for the last 25 years. He also asserted that Sk. Mojahar was of sound mind on October 14, 1992 when the Hebanama was executed and registered.
